Epicor Connected Process Control
Epicor Connected Process Control offers an intuitive software solution designed to create and manage digital work instructions while maintaining strict process control, effectively minimizing the chances of errors in operations. By integrating IoT devices, it captures comprehensive time studies and detailed process data, including images, at the task level, providing unprecedented real-time visibility and quality oversight. The eFlex system is versatile enough to accommodate countless product variations and thousands of components, catering to both component-based and model-based manufacturers alike. Furthermore, work instructions seamlessly connect to the Bill of Materials, guaranteeing that products are assembled correctly every time, even when modifications occur during production. This advanced system intelligently adapts to variations in models and components, ensuring that only the relevant work instructions for the current build at the station are presented, enhancing efficiency and accuracy throughout the manufacturing process. In this way, Epicor empowers manufacturers to maintain high standards of quality control while adapting to the dynamic nature of production demands.

MV2
MV2 serves as a highly efficient and powerful Manufacturing Execution System (MES) designed to optimize the utilization of current resources and processes without the expense of additional automation or workforce expansion. This MES seamlessly integrates with PLC-level systems and existing Microsoft F&O ERP, enabling real-time monitoring and management of personnel and machinery throughout the manufacturing facility. It acts as a software platform that links, observes, and synchronizes the intricate systems, data exchanges, and personnel on the shop floor. The primary function of an MES is to manage and streamline the execution of manufacturing tasks, thereby enhancing overall production efficiency within the factory. By utilizing MES, shop floor employees can concentrate on their tasks rather than being distracted by excessive reading or data entry, which ultimately leads to a more efficient work environment. Furthermore, the integration of MV2 MES fosters a more connected and responsive manufacturing ecosystem, allowing for better decision-making and resource allocation.
